Looking for some guidance/advice, or general help with my Blackvue 650 two channel into my 2013 BMW 640d.
I bought the dashcams along with the "Power Magic Pro" as was advised to me, and after checking various YouTube installs. I also bought the little "add a fuse" connector.
I referred back to the YouTube video regarding a typical install into a BMW, and then found the advice: "do not connect via the fuse box, hard wire directly to the battery!"
Ah, ok.
So I checked the YouTube videos for hard wire. Seems simple enough.
So, I have set up the cameras, hidden all the wires and connected and located the Power Magic Pro in the boot of the car.
Booted it up and hey presto, it all worked. Great! Right?
No.
After a short while the camera tells me its switching off. So I reboot it and it all works again. Only for it to tell me that its switching itself off after a while.
Now I have checked the setting in the Power Magic Pro, to ensure that it has power to it for up to 12 hours. And the voltage is correct at 11.8v.
So, back to YouTube for some assistance, only to find another video that tells me "do not use a Power Magic Pro with a modern BMW, and never connect to the battery, as your car could go on fire!"
Wow!
So, out to the car, and off with the Power Magic Pro, as now I don't trust it.
I then find another piece of equipment being touted a "Multi Safer" and its connection to a fuse in the fuse box for BMW's.
A quick search doesn't seem to produce anything for the UK though, and it looks suspiciously like the Power Magic Pro.
So now, I have the Blackvue kit, installed in my car, with no power.
What is going on, and who to listen to.
Anyone out there had similar?
